Overview

Join our Network Infrastructure Optical Systems and Networking R&D team as an R&D Software Optical Designer! In this hybrid role, you'll collaborate in our state-of-the-art lab equipped with cutting-edge communications and next-gen R&D tools. Your work will focus on enhancing subsea communications by developing intelligent optical systems that optimize performance during commissioning and predict potential degradation to recommend timely remediation actions. You'll engage with cross-functional teams, including DSP, Systems, and SW engineers, while directly interfacing with customers. Enjoy the benefit of contributing to innovative projects encompassing customer commissioning software, cloud tools, R&D simulations, and design aspects of subsea communication. Design and develop innovative software solutions to optimize subsea optical links for enhanced performance and reliability. Create user-friendly interfaces to facilitate customer-facing software for efficient commissioning of EDFA and RAMAN backhaul links. Develop algorithms to monitor cable aging, execute retesting, and ensure seamless recommissioning of subsea cables. Implement smart algorithms to upgrade existing cable systems while maintaining live traffic for uninterrupted service. Conduct GN model simulations for accurate commissioning and predictive analysis of customer's subsea cable systems.
